Sales Manager at ffffff - Kenai, Alaska, United States
fffff
Contact Kevin Le
fff
Contact Vamsi Deepak
eps
Contact Georgette Ul
ffff
Contact Marat Kurbano
vigilante
Contact Adriana Justo
Contact Hasbleidy Gonzalez
Contact Parna Tarafdar
tttttt